摘要
着重研究了5231/T300复合材料的常规力学性能和高温下的力学性能,并与5222/T300复合材料的相应性能进行了对比。试验表明,前者在抗压缩模量和抗剪切性能方面比后者略低,其他力学性能基本相当,耐高温性能良好,另外,5231碳布预浸料可与铝蜂窝直接共固化,抗滚筒剥离强度较高,该复合材料可应用于飞机的结构件上。
The mechanical properties of 5231/T300 composite at room temperature and high temperature, which are compared with those of 5222/T300 composite are typically studied in this paper. The tests shows that the compressive modulus and shear properties of the former one are a little lower than those of the latter one, the other properties of them is basically matched, the properties at high-temperature for 5231/T300 composite are good. In addition, the 5231/G803 carbon cloth prepreg can be co-cured directly with aluminum honeycomb. The climbing drum peel strength of the sandwich structure is high. In one word, the 5231/carbon fiber composite can be applied in the structural parts of aircrafts.
